Kalàscima — Psychedelic Trance Tarantella

Kalàscima is an infectious trance-folk experience of percussion, vocal, and electronic sound. As one of Italy’s most acclaimed contemporary musical collaborations, Kalàscima is unique in its energy and rhythm, a fusion of the ancient and modern in an all night revelation of sound.
The explosive, energetic and captivating Kalàscima comprises six members, who share about 25 instruments between themselves – ranging from bouzouki to zampogna (Italian bagpipes) traditional flutes, italian organetto, a spectacularly large array of percussion and thrilling vocal and modern instruments (bass guitar and loop machine), and even a kanjira.
There is a family-like bond between Luca Buccarella, Federico Laganà, Massimiliano De Marco, Riccardo Basile, Aldo Iezza and Roberto Chiga, all of whom grew up together in rural Salento. They picked up the traditional Italian folk music from their grandparents and added current musical instruments and technology.
